One of the differences between typical cake pops and these is the fact that I added cookie dough to the mix. You may have to freeze them a few minutes longer so they hold their shape, but they’re worth it.
My daughter and her friends LOVED these.
I rolled them in Andes Peppermint Crunch Chips, but you could crush candy canes or any peppermint candy you have on hand.
Using the same batter, I also rolled some in Peppermint Oreos and crushed peppermint sticks just to change things up a bit.

Ingredients
- 1 boxed yellow cake, made according to directions and cooled
- 1 container cream cheese frosting
- 2 cups chocolate chip cookie dough (storebought is fine)
- White melting chocolate, or white chocolate chips
- Milk chocolate melting chocolate, or milk chocolate chips
- Andes Peppermint Chips
- Mint Oreos
- Peppermint sticks, crushed
- Sucker sticks
Instructions
- Combine cooled cake, frosting and cookie dough; roll into balls and place on cookie sheet in freezer for at least 30 minutes to an hour.
- Melt chocolates.
- Insert sticks into cake pops and roll in chocolate, then crushed cookies and candies.
- Place on wax paper and freeze for an additional 30 minutes before serving.
